The cheapest way to get from Valencia to Moixent is to drive which costs €12 - €19 and takes 53 min.
The fastest way to get from Valencia to Moixent is to drive which takes 53 min and costs €12 - €19.
No, there is no direct bus from Valencia to Moixent. However, there are services departing from Estació d'Autobusos de València and arriving at Moixent via Xàtiva.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 3h 7m.
The distance between Valencia and Moixent is 87 km. The road distance is 80.6 km.
